Well, looks like the weekend came earlier.....

I DL'd & installed this little tool kit and really like it.
Installation was as super easy compared to the mod install I suggested earlier.
All that it needed was an upload to the server and then displaying the page.
On the first run, it asked me to create a password and away it went.
No php codes to edit, no tables to create, seriously no muss, no fuss.

Playing around with the features for a bit, and IMHO it's definately a "must have" for phpbb forums.
All it takes to perform several actions on one or more users is a few simple mouse clicks.
Also has a section to edit board settings, and a nifty security scan.
The scan checks if the board & toolkit versions are up to date, for potentially hacked user accounts, and for any malicious code in the forum or site descriptions.

I tried a couple hacks on the toolkit (that I know of) to see if there were any security flaws, but so far I haven't found any.
All in all....I think it's a clean, simple and very useful tool for anyone who runs a phpbb forum.
